## Brimhollow KV Gateway: Bloom Filter Limits

Plugins querying the Brimhollow key-value store pass through a shared bloom filter that short-circuits lookups for absent keys. Because the filter is shared across all plugin tenants, its sizing and false-positive budget are fixed platform-wide and cannot be overridden per plugin. Exceeding the insertion quota triggers a rotation, which temporarily raises false-positive rates for everyone. Plugin authors should plan around the following constants:

tuning table, yajog-yahof:
BUDGETS = {
    "lamvan": 303,
    "wenox": 460,
    "fenvan": 525,
}

**Ticket #—: Plugin vault locked (telemetry compression)**

Hey plugin folks — the Squishlane vault holding the compression codec keys locked itself after the rotation job hiccuped. Until it's reopened, gzip fallback is fine; zstd payloads will bounce. We're unsealing it today so your builds stop failing. For anyone who needs to do it themselves, the recovery passphrase is below.

recovery phrase for fajep-yaweg: gilath-sorox-wenius-rusdor-keliel-zorius

Release gate 7 (security sign-off): Confirm the LiftWeave dispatch simulator ships with the sandboxed scenario loader enabled by default, and that operator-injected scenario files are schema-validated before deserialization. Verify the audit log captures every dispatch-override event with a monotonic sequence number, and that the hall-call fuzzing suite passed on the final candidate. No debug endpoints may remain reachable on the simulator's admin port. Once all boxes are checked, record the build token shown here for the review dossier.

pipeline stamp: htk9_ce63042d9

Subject: Welcome aboard + Graphlet key rotation

Hi folks,

Welcome to the Mapwell team! Quick housekeeping: we rotated the credential for Graphlet, our dependency graph visualizer, this morning. If you followed last week's setup guide, your local config is now pointing at a dead key — sorry about that. The rotation was routine (quarterly schedule, nothing scary), but it does mean the visualizer will show an empty graph until you update. Swap in the new key below and restart the Graphlet daemon.

app token of tagef-tafog = qvz3-7n0